> ARM64 Linux is supporting both 4KB and 64KB page granularity. Although, Xen
> hypercall interface and PV protocol are always based on 4KB page granularity.
>
> Any attempt to boot a Linux guest with 64KB pages enabled will result to a
> guest crash.
>
> This series is a first attempt to allow those Linux running with the current
> hypercall interface and PV protocol.
>
> This solution has been chosen because we want to run Linux 64KB in released
> Xen ARM version or/and platform using an old version of Linux DOM0.
>
> There is room for improvement, such as support of 64KB grant, modification
> of PV protocol to support different page size... They will be explored in a
> separate patch series later.
>
> TODO list:
> - Convert swiotlb to 64KB
> - Convert xenfb to 64KB
> - Check if backend in QEMU works with DOM0 64KB
> - It may be possible to move some common define between
> netback/netfront and blkfront/blkback in an header
>
> All patches has been built tested for ARM32, ARM64, x86. But I haven't tested
> to run it on x86 as I don't have a box with Xen x86 running. I would be
> happy if someone give a try and see possible regression for x86.
